Обновить dags/fin_porfel.py
This commit is contained in:
parent
c1e059bfca
commit
9092059ebf
|
|
@ -71,7 +71,14 @@ def upsert_list_fin_portfel(**kwargs):
|
||||||
)
|
)
|
||||||
conn.execute("""
|
conn.execute("""
|
||||||
UPDATE public.fin_porfel fp
|
UPDATE public.fin_porfel fp
|
||||||
SET fp.id = row_number() over (order by uid_dogovor, schet, summa_dogovora)
|
SET id = subquery.new_id
|
||||||
|
FROM (
|
||||||
|
SELECT
|
||||||
|
id,
|
||||||
|
ROW_NUMBER() OVER (ORDER BY uid_dogovor, schet, summa_dogovora) as new_id
|
||||||
|
FROM public.fin_porfel
|
||||||
|
) AS subquery
|
||||||
|
WHERE fp.id = subquery.id;
|
||||||
"""
|
"""
|
||||||
)
|
)
|
||||||
return 'Список обновлен.'
|
return 'Список обновлен.'
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ue